Before you visit the exhibition, let students know they'll be able to explore many kinds of mythic creatures from different cultures and time periods. Read aloud "What is a mythic creature?" and discuss the Key Concepts with students. To continue the dialogue, ask:

  • What mythic creatures have you encountered in books, artwork, television, video games, comics, and other media? List them.

  • What do you know about these creatures?

  • Do these creatures have symbolic meaning? Solicit examples.
